Guyver IV is based on the character from the Japanese Anime series Guyver. In the series there are only three individuals with Guyver armor, so I made my version of a fourth.
About this creation
In the anime series, each one of the armors are very similar to each other while posessing distinct variations in armor design and color. The completed MOC stands 24.5 inches tall. While remaining true to the Guyver designs, I did slight variations in the armor and chose a color that hadn't been used.
